WebTransport is a new protocol that combines the low latency of WebSockets with the reliability of HTTP/3. In this episode, Lucas and Luna explore how WebTransport enables efficient, bidirectional, real-time communication for applications like live gaming, collaborative editing, and IoT streaming. They walk through a concrete example: a startup building a multiplayer drawing app that switches from WebSockets to WebTransport, cutting latency by 40% and handling packet loss without retransmission delays. They discuss the protocol's use of QUIC streams, unidirectional streams, and datagrams, and compare it to WebSockets and HTTP/2 server push. They also cover current browser support, polyfill options, and when NOT to use WebTransport.
